The MPC8280 supports partially filled cells configured on a per-VC basis. In this mode,
only the valid octets are filled with user information; the rest of the cell is filled with
padding octets.
The MPC8280 supports synchronous residual time stamp (SRTS) generation using an
external PLL. If this mode is enabled, the MPC8280 reads the SRTS code from external
logic and inserts it into four outgoing cells. See Section 31.16, "SRTS Generation and
Clock Recovery Using External Logic."
32.2.2 Signaling Path
The MPC8280 automatically handles the signaling information as part of the interworking
function. The ATM transmitter packs the signaling information at the end of each
superframe during the data segmentation process. Each VC is associated to one signaling
block by an internal routing table; see Section 32.4.6, "Channel Associated Signaling
(CAS) Support." The signaling information that resides in the internal RAM is inserted into
the AAL1 cell according to the af-vtoa-0078 specification.
The AAL1 structure is divided into two sections. The first section carries the Nx64 payload,
and the second carries the signaling bits that are associated with the payload.
The MPC8280 supports two framing modes: one for Nx64 DS1 ESF (extended superframe)
framing, and the other for Nx64 E1 G.704 framing. See Figure 32-3. Each of the internal
signaling blocks can be used to deliver only one of the framing formats; that is, they cannot
be changed dynamically.

32.3 AAL1 CES Receiver Overview
The ATM controller supports both AAL1 structured and unstructured formats. For the
unstructured format, 47 octets are copied to the current receive buffer and for the structured
format, 46 (P format) or 47 (non-P format) octets are copied to the current receive buffer.
